European Immunization Week (EIW) is marked across Europe every year in the final week of April. It aims to raise awareness of the importance of immunisation for the general health and well-being of the European and wider population.
Globally, as of 9 August, 19 cases of polio due to wild poliovirus type 1 (WPV1) and 223 cases due to circulating vaccine derived poliovirus (cVDPV) have been reported this year. In 2022, the cVDPV cases have been reported in 15 countries, with 93% of the cases attributed to cVDPV type 2 (cVDPV2).
